Shield Highlights:
- Contains 1 oz of .999 fine Silver.
- Limited to a mintage of only 2,448 mystery packs.
- Shaped and colorized state shields come in a shaped capsule within a Route 66-themed mystery pack.
- Obverse: Each highway shield is designed to match the instantly recognizable shape of the Route 66 road sign. Each Mystery Pack features one of eight possible colorized designs: Arizona (mintage of 401), California (mintage of 314), Missouri (mintage of 317), New Mexico (mintage of 484), Illinois (mintage of 301), Texas (mintage of 186), Oklahoma (mintage of 432) and Kansas (mintage of 13).
- Reverse: Reads "Route 66", similar to the iconic road sign, and lists the Silver weight and purity.

100th Anniversary of Route 66
Marking its 100th anniversary, Route 66— often called the "Main Street of America" remains one of the most iconic roadways in U.S. history. Established in 1926, Route 66 originally stretched over 2,400 miles from Chicago to Santa Monica, connecting small towns and major cities while shaping American travel culture. Today, the centennial celebration highlights its legacy of classic roadside attractions, vintage diners, neon signs and scenic desert landscapes that continue to attract travels worldwide. As interest in nostalgic road trips and Americana tourism grows, Route 66's 100th anniversary serves as the perfect opportunity to explore its historic charm, preserved landmarks and enduring influence on American culture and travel.
